STONHOUSE-VIGOR, ALFRED HENRY SAY.
Adm. pens. at ST JOHN'S, Oct. 10, 1851.
S. of the Rev. Henry (above) [and Louisa Burt]. B. [June 24, 1832], at Eaton Bishop, Heref.
Bapt. Aug. 11, 1832. [School, Ilminster Grammar.] Matric. Michs. 1851; B.A. 1856; M.A. 1861.
Adm. at Lincoln's Inn, Jan. 19, 1857.
Called to the Bar, Nov. 17, 1860.
Revising Barrister, Western Circuit.
Recorder of Penzance, 1877-83; of Southampton, 1883-9. Married, Apr. 27, 1867, Gertrude, youngest dau. of William Bird, J.P., of Crouch Hill, Hornsey.
Died June 24, 1889, in London .
( Eagle, XVI. 179; Foster, Men at the Bar; The Guardian, July 3, 1889.)
